Utilization of quartz quarry dust as a sustainable partial sand replacement in cement mortar

Key Points
Utilizing quartz quarry dust improves compressive strength in cement mortar, reaching up to 25% increase compared to traditional sand.
Incorporating 5-25% quartz quarry dust significantly enhances the mortar's mechanical properties and sustainability.
The approach involved assessing compressive strength in relation to varying percentages of quartz quarry dust as a sand replacement.
These findings support the need for more sustainable materials in construction, with potential implications for industry practices.
